Swim Recap Day 3 Summit League Championships

Panthers Break Four School Records On Day Three

Panthers complete day three of the Summit League Championships

2/20/2026 9:04:00 PM

The Eastern Illinois swim team completed day three of the Summit League Championships. Panthers were highlighted by four new school records. Alexander Sadowski placed 5th in the 100 Yard Backstroke A-final. EIU will compete on the final day of the championships on Saturday.  



Men's Swimming: 

Luke Helm placed 14th in the 100 Yard Butterfly prelims to advance to the B final, in which he placed 15th with a time of 49.57, which is the fastest time in EIU history. Right behind him was Canyon Bain, who advanced to the B final in the 100 Yard Butterfly, placing 14th with a time of 49.56, which is now the second-fastest time in Panther's history.  

Nolan Wallace placed 16th in the 100 Yard Breaststroke with a time of 56.38. Wallace competed in the B Final, finishing 11th with a time of 55.80, which broke the record for the fastest time in EIU history.  

Alexander Sadowski finished 6th in the 100 Yard Backstroke with a time of 48.76. Sadowski advanced to the A Final, scoring a 5th place finish with a time of 48.49, which broke the record for the fastest time in EIU history.   

Robert Higgins placed 14th in the 100 Yard Backstroke with a time of 50.27, advancing to the B final. In the B final, he finished 15th with a time of 50.26, which ranks 5th all-time in EIU history.  

The 400 Medley Relay team finished 5th with a time of 3:18.78, which is the fastest time in EIU history.  



Women's Swimming: 

Sydney VanderVelde placed 7th in the 400 IM prelims with a time of 4:32.67, which is the second fastest time in EIU history. VanderVelde advanced to the A final and placed 8th with a finals time of 4:38.47. 

Sophia Buswell earned a top ten finish in the 100 Yard Butterfly to advance to the B final, in which she placed 5th with a time of 57.57, which ranks 7th all-time in the program record book. 

Genevieve Biberdorf finished 9th in the 100 Yard Breaststroke preliminary round with a time of 1:04.61. Biberdorf advanced to the B final and finished 10th with a time of 1:04.22, which is the fastest time in EIU history.
